I've always said that TNA has one major problem, and its that it has a responsibility to cater to two completely different demographics.
TNA: IMPACT! airs on Spike TV, the first network for men which caters to the 18-34 male demographic. So they need to use cheap tricks like violence, sexual themes and profanity to cater to an adult crowd.
However, IMPACT! is taped in WALT DISNEY WORLD in Orlando Florida, which means that THERE ARE A LOT OF CHILDREN IN THE AUDIENCE. These two things seem to be at constant odds with one another. It is offensive to have TNA use profanity and over the top blood and violence in front of children in that way, simply for the greater good of catering to a national audience. Do children really need to see Crimson virtually murder Abyss with a bat full of nails?
I've always said TNA needs to do one of two things. 1) Film IMPACT! at another venue where they can get a more adult audience. Or 2) Switch Networks, become PG, and begin filming IMPACT! as a wrestling-centric program on the Dysney channel.
I know everyone is gonna say that last idea is absurd, but really. Consider how conflicting it is to have Spike TV and Disney World associated with one another. You can not adequately satisfy the needs of both parties.
